## Service Accounts: Spoolhawk

Spoolhawk (printer-spooler microservice) runs under svc-spoolhawk in all environments. Release notes: credential rotation happens the Tuesday before each cut; confirm rotation completed before tagging. Queue drain must finish before redeploy or jobs duplicate. Spoolhawk authenticates to the internal Inkwell job registry at startup using the key below.

service key, fawip-bajef: kto11_Qt5wZK9vdNC

## Deploying the Gatewick Proctor Queue

Deploys are pretty painless: push to main, wait for the pipeline, then watch the queue drain dashboard for five minutes. If candidates pile up mid-exam, roll back first and ask questions later — the queue replays safely. Everything the workers care about lives in one config block, shown here for reference.

settings of bafof-yagef:
JOROX_PIN=8740
JOROX_TENANT=pelox
JOROX_METRICS_HOST=metrics.jorox.qorvelworks.internal
JOROX_SEAL=seal_c78f63c1
JOROX_STANDBY_TEAM=norax

## Session Handling for Health Checks

The Corvel gateway sits behind the Lanternside load balancer, which probes /healthz every ten seconds. Health-check requests are stateless by design: they bypass the session store entirely so that probe traffic never inflates session counts or evicts real user sessions. New team members should note that the deep-check endpoint, /healthz/deep, does verify session-store connectivity and therefore requires authentication. When probing it manually, supply the token below.

bearer token for tajep-kajef: eyJhbGciOiJIUzI1NiIsInR5cCI6IkpXVCJ9.eyJzdWIiOiIoOsZ23In0.CsygO0hs

MINUTES — Management Meeting, Ostevale Office

Present: R. Calmett, D. Ivorsen, P. Lanque. Topic: pilot with Bramwick Stores. Rollout covers four locations; staffing confirmed. Ivorsen reported returns under 2%. Calmett to finalise pricing memo by Friday. Board approval sought for phase two. The confidential expansion note follows for board eyes only.

internal memo for yahag-hahig: Belwynix Group plans to lower the Silir list price by 62 percent in May.